Transaction c12f04dfd693b51f966d3640a7f2117f3884a0424c30d4db3f69f724fb0fa57d
1 Input
2 Outputs
- c12f04dfd693b51f966d3640a7f2117f3884a0424c30d4db3f69f724fb0fa57d:0
- c12f04dfd693b51f966d3640a7f2117f3884a0424c30d4db3f69f724fb0fa57d:1
value 75430
address 14uHeQNPAhUwz5RoQkejAxb5Y3KPgXiCnG
value 599589820
address 123TsPbf4GrtpJ4P1Hk9znxr9LQoDiWYgS